Clean up VLAN/VNI bridge mappings when removing L2 endpoints, allowing re-deployment with different parameters in the same session. Signed-off-by: Sergei Volkov <sevolkov@redhat.com> Assisted-by: Claude Opus 4.6 <noreply@anthropic.com>
Emulates migration of an external L2 workload into the cluster
as a CUDN VM, preserving its IP and MAC addresses. The old endpoint
is torn down and re-created with new IPs while the VM takes over
the original identity.
test_source_provider_migration uses @pytest.mark.order("last")
because it tears down the shared L2 endpoint, which would break
other tests if run earlier.

What this PR does / why we need it:
Add source provider migration test for EVPN.
allowing re-deployment with different parameters in the same test session.
macAddressfield toInterfacedataclass for explicit MAC assignment.deploy_evpn_l2_endpoint.test_source_provider_migration: emulates migration of an external L2workload into the cluster as a CUDN VM, preserving its IP and MAC addresses.
The old endpoint is torn down, a VM takes over the original identity, then a
new L2 endpoint is deployed with different IPs to verify connectivity.
Which issue(s) this PR fixes:
Special notes for reviewer:
test_source_provider_migrationuses@pytest.mark.order("last")because ittears down the shared L2 endpoint, which would break other tests if run earlier.
random_ipv6_address()generates addresses with a random 7th hextet,but OVN IPAM caps /64 allocation to 65536 addresses.
Replaced with a low-offset hardcoded address. Only affects IPs requested via
network.kubevirt.io/addresses; external netns endpoints are unaffected.The known bug: https://redhat.atlassian.net/browse/OCPBUGS-86810
known limitation — currently only one L2 endpoint can exist at a time. A follow-up
will reorganise fixtures to separate VLAN lifecycle from endpoints, enabling
independent concurrent endpoints.
